DIY vs Professional Air Duct Cleaning Methods in Winnetka Homes

Key Differences Between Cleaning Approaches

  1. DIY cleaning focuses on visible dust removal using household tools such as vacuums and brushes
  2. Professional cleaning uses advanced equipment to reach deep into duct systems
  3. DIY methods require time, effort, and basic knowledge of HVAC components
  4. Professional services provide comprehensive cleaning for the entire system

Factors to Consider Before Choosing

  • DIY is ideal for light maintenance and surface cleaning
  • Professionals handle deep contamination and hidden buildup
  • DIY tools are limited in reach and effectiveness
  • Professionals follow industry standards and duct cleaning best practices

Signs You Need Professional Air Duct Cleaning

Common Warning Indicators

  • Dust buildup around vents and registers
  • Uneven temperatures in different rooms
  • Weak airflow from HVAC vents
  • Persistent odors when the system runs

Additional Performance Clues

  • Increased energy bills without higher usage
  • Frequent system cycling on and off
  • Allergy symptoms or respiratory discomfort
  • Reduced system efficiency over time

Practical Maintenance Tips for Cleaner Air Ducts

Maintaining clean ducts requires consistent effort and attention. Simple daily and seasonal habits can significantly reduce buildup and improve system performance. Replacing air filters regularly is one of the most effective ways to prevent dust and debris from entering the duct system. Clean filters allow air to flow freely and improve efficiency, while keeping vents clean and unobstructed ensures proper airflow throughout your home.

Your Air Duct Concerns Answered

What is DIY vs professional air duct cleaning?

It refers to the comparison between self-cleaning methods and professional services used to maintain air duct systems

How often should air ducts be cleaned?

Most homes require professional cleaning every three to five years, depending on usage and environmental conditions

Is DIY cleaning effective?

DIY cleaning can help with minor maintenance, but it does not remove deep contaminants inside the system

When should I hire professionals?

Professional cleaning is recommended when there is heavy buildup poor airflow or persistent odors

Does cleaning ducts improve air quality?

Yes, removing dust and debris improves airflow and reduces allergens in the home
